The parameter P6 defines this action operating mode: it can have different values:
All these operating modes (with the exception of the “Delete list” operating mode) are expecting a table in input. This input table will be injected inside the given list inside the given Sharepoint site in Azure. Ideally, this input table should have a column named “Title” because Sharepoint is imposing that all lists have a “Title” column. We are suggesting you to have a “Title” column in the table in input but you can also decide to ignore our recommendation: In this case, SharePoint will automatically add an empty “Title” column inside your list.
